Astinus Posted June 18, 2016 Author Share Posted June 18, 2016 Yes...Epoxied the 2 Duncans. Used the Sandwich method. SG Gel, epoxy, gel. I didn't like having the Duncans out for to long. I Held them upside down while gluing the sandwich, they started to drip a slime. I affixed them where I wanted. They recovered within a day or 2. I plan on uploading some pics sometime soon.
